Bidvest Noonan is seeking Security Officers to ensure the safety of client premises through proactive patrolling and CCTV operation. The ideal candidate will have a SIA Door Supervisor License, valid UK Driving License, and strong customer service skills.
Responsibilities include:
- Advising management on security issues
- Complying with operational procedures
- Providing exceptional service
The position offers ongoing training, uniform, paid holidays, and progression opportunities.
